The claim that agentic AI will remake work next year isn't a prediction from a single enthusiast. It's the consensus of executives surveyed by DeepL and the basis for concrete advice from consultants and HR platforms on how to adapt. Jarek Kutylowski, DeepL's chief executive and founder, put the point plainly: "AI agents are no longer experimental, they're inevitable." The survey of 5,000 leaders across five major economies found 69 percent expect transformation in 2026, 44 percent expect major transformation, 25 percent say change is already underway, and only 7 percent expect no change.
Rethink roles around tasks and capabilities
The managerial demand is simple. Organisations must stop treating jobs as fixed titles and start treating them as bundles of tasks that can be reassigned between humans and agents. That's exactly the shift KPMG UK describes: moving from job-title-based allocation to skill and task-based frameworks, and redesigning workforce planning, learning and rewards around capability rather than fixed roles. Workday UK argues leaders should invest in employee experience, tools and training so staff can work with agents rather than be displaced by them.
Practical steps from consultants map directly onto that framework. Bernard Marr sets out three actions professionals can take now: build AI literacy, decompose roles into tasks to identify what can be handed to agents, and map the available agentic platforms for role-specific delegation. Marr gives concrete examples. Firms can use agents to orchestrate email campaigns, or automate early-stage recruitment steps, shifting routine coordination and candidate screening tasks away from human time. The implication isn't that people vanish. DeepL respondents were split: more than half said AI will create more new roles next year than it replaces, and 52 percent said AI skills will be required for most new hires.
The DeepL data explains why companies are moving: measurable ROI and efficiency were cited by 22 percent of executives as a top driver for deploying agents. Workforce adaptability and enterprise readiness followed at 18 percent apiece. The main barriers, meanwhile, are cost at 16 percent, workforce preparedness at 13 percent, and technology maturity at 12 percent. Those figures make clear where managers must focus: demonstrate return on investment, upskill staff, and pilot agent deployments until maturity and integration reduce the cost friction.
The workplace reorganisation doesn't happen in a policy vacuum. Former prime minister Rishi Sunak argued in The Times that employer national insurance contributions raise the immediate cost of hiring while deploying AI carries no equivalent tax, creating a fiscal bias that could push firms toward automation.
Employer NIC raises more than £100 billion annually for the Treasury, a revenue base Sunak and others say must be rethought in an era where automation is an economically workable alternative to recruitment.
Sunak used a mixture of national and international data to frame the issue. He noted that independent research cited by him found no clear rise in unemployment in AI-exposed roles since the arrival of generative models, but it did identify a slowdown in hiring, most notably among 22 to 25 year olds. Industry data from the British Standards Institution reported 41 percent of businesses saying AI is enabling headcount reductions and that nearly a third now consider AI solutions before hiring. Internationally, Sunak pointed to the scale of job disruption in the United States, where more than 1.17 million jobs were cut in 2025 amid post-pandemic restructuring, to argue this is a broader labour-market shift.
The policy responses proposed in the material run three ways. First, some suggest cutting employment taxes to encourage hiring. Second, others argue for levies on firms that replace jobs with automation, to recapture revenue and slow an immediate swing toward robots over recruits. Third, several sources recommend an AI economics institute with access to live job-market data, a body that would track hiring, displacement and the fiscal effects of automation in near real time. No timetable for such an institute was specified in the reporting, but the proposal would give policymakers the data they currently lack.
Those who oppose urgent tax changes point to the optimistic judgments inside companies. Many executives report measurable performance gains and expect net job creation through AI. That's a legitimate counter-argument. The work from DeepL itself shows firms see ROI and readiness as strong drivers, which suggests adoption is often demand led rather than purely cost led. But the survey and industry data together also show a real risk: where hiring costs are high and agent deployments are immediate and untaxed, the incentives to automate first and hire later are powerful. The consequence isn't simply a mechanical loss of jobs. It's a change in career pathways, with younger cohorts facing slower entry and fewer on-the-job learning opportunities in routine tasks that are now handed to agents.
For managers the response is operational. Map tasks, upskill for AI collaboration, measure ROI and treat adoption as a capability play not a one-off saving. For policymakers the choice is fiscal. Either accept a structural move toward automation and redesign tax and social support around that outcome, or alter incentives so hiring remains attractive where human judgement, learning and entry-level experience matter most.
